What problems did Great Britain’s postwar economy have?

Respuesta :

Ammimochi
Ammimochi Ammimochi
  • 02-11-2017
It slowed down considerably, due to outdated equipment, loss of valuable personnel, loss of colonies, and decrease in coal consumption.
